My floor in Downtown Mansfield is dry to the touch. Is it actually dry?

No. 'Dry to the touch' is a surface condition and does not reflect the psychrometric equilibrium within materials. The S500 standard of care for our climate requires drying to a specific vapor pressure, achieving a moisture content equivalent to 40 Grains Per Pound (GPP) at 70°F. We use thermo-hygrometers and deep-probe meters to measure this, as unaddressed moisture in wood and concrete will migrate, causing secondary damage.

Mansfield is in Flood Zone X. Why do I need specialized drying for my basement?

While Zone X denotes a low-risk flood area, 2026 FEMA Risk MAP updates emphasize localized groundwater and seepage risks. Basements and crawlspaces have unique psychrometrics, often requiring controlled dehumidification and air exchange to manage high ambient humidity. A Zone X rating does not eliminate the need for structural drying protocols to prevent mold and wood decay in these encapsulated spaces.

How quickly does mold become a concern after a leak?

The mold growth window is 48-72 hours in a typical Mansfield environment. If mitigation does not begin within this window, the liability for resulting microbial growth can shift from your insurance carrier to the homeowner under 2026 claim protocols. Professional remediation, including containment and HEPA filtration, becomes the required standard of care to prevent cross-contamination.
